Dear friend, As you are aware, C. Saratchandran, one of the most prominent film activists in South India passed away on April, 1, 2010. This incident has given a major shock, grief and a vaccum to all friends, supporters and his family. Friends of Sarat have already initiated different meetings to remember him in different parts of the country. The important films he made are being shown around in different parts of the country as Saratchandran Retrospective. Activists are also trying to initiate Saratchandran Memorial Film Archives in different parts so that activists and people’s movements can get access to socially relevant films.
Sarat has been active in the production, screenings, facilitating groups and movements through films for the last two and a half decades. The role he played cannot be duplicated.
